基本数据类型 声明方式 let xxx= ref<type>('defaultValue'); let xxx= ref('defaultValue') 举例说明 let name = ref<string>('coco'); let newname= ref(''); let age= ref<number>(18); let newage=ref(16) let isNewFlag=ref<boolean>(true) let isOldFlag=ref(false) 修改数据举例(在方法...
1. 通过Vue.js官方提供的Vue.js CLI:Vue.js CLI是一个命令行工具,可以快速创建Vue.js应用程序,并且可以使用Vue.js CLI来声明Vue3TSREF。2. 通过Vue.js官方提供的Vue.js CDN:Vue.js CDN是一个公共CDN,可以在网页中快速引入Vue.js应用程序,并且可以使用Vue.js CDN来声明Vue3TSREF。3. 通过Vue.js官方提供...
一、ref定义类型 consta=ref('')//根据输入参数推导字符串类型 Ref<string>constb=ref<string[]>([])//可以通过范型显示约束 Ref<string[]>constc:Ref<string[]>=ref([])//声明类型 Ref<string[]>constlist=ref([1,3,5])console.log('list前:',list.value)list.value[1]=7console.log('list后:...
trackRefValue和triggerRefValue,它们的声明同样在ref.ts这个文件里面,我们来看看 // 说在前面: // __DEV__这个是Vue的一个区分开发环境和生产环境的变量,开发环境需要提供代码的报错啊等一些具体信息,但是开发环境不需要,所以,我们在看到__DEV__这个变量的时候,可以忽略,不会影响到对代码的理解 // get export...
,代码如下 /* 注:!.的意思其实就是让ts知道这个对象不是undefined或者是null,在js里面单独!意思是取反,所以希望注意用的时候不要搞混掉 */ treeRef.value!.getCheckedNodes()
[1, 2]); let ts_ref3 = ref(1); ts_ref3.value = "1"; // reactive // 显性的给变量进行标注 interface student { name: string; age?: number; [orders: string]: any; } const ts_reactive: student = reactive({ id: 1, name: "小明", age: 12, }); // computed // 调用computed...
1回答 如何使用ts在vue3中将引用数据定义为类类型 、、、 我想使用ref来创建一个类。它可以用作可由.调用的类实例export default declare class Cropper {}const cropper =ref<Cropper 浏览32提问于2021-06-06得票数 2 回答已采纳 1回答 Typescript声明文件不包括其他声明文件引用 我构建了一个TypeSc...
父级件: <template><MyLoginref="MyLoginRef"/>按钮</template>import { ref } from 'vue' import MyLogin from './components/MyLogin.vue' const MyLoginRef = ref<InstanceType<typeofMyLogin>| null>() const hanldClick = () => { MyLoginRef.value?.sayHello...
组合式API, 一般用ref:typeMytype={value1:string;value2:number}constarr=ref<Mytype[]|null>(null...
接下来我们补全一下数据,这里使用ref作为响应对象 Vue 复制代码 9 1 2 3 4 5 6 7 import{ref}from'vue' letfirstName=ref('zhang') letlastName=ref('san') 接下来我们引入一个知识点v-model 使用v-model指令可以简化表单数据的处理,使得开发者无...